Munnar in April: doable, with the right plan

Good time to visit · fit score 72/100Crowds: medium

April: 11 rainy days — and outside the recommended window.

Munnar is generally best visited in September – March.

What the weather actually does

10-year average · Munnar

Warm days around 25°C, nights near 16°C, frequent rain.

Getting to Munnar

Usually the biggest line in the budget — and the one the estimate above leaves out.

Kochi → Munnar

bus · 4h

₹200

1 way / person

Kochi → Munnar

cab · 3.5h

₹2,500

1 way / person

Cheapest listed route is Kochi → Munnar by bus. Return for two works out to about ₹800 — so a whole trip lands near ₹9,450 for two, travel included.

Fares are typical one-way estimates per person from Munnar's common gateways, not live prices — book early and expect festival months to run higher.
